A leading recruitment agency is seeking an experienced Account Director to manage high-end retail campaigns for luxury FMCG brands. This mid-senior level role involves leading global shopper initiatives and collaborating with senior teams to ensure effective delivery.
Candidates should possess a strong agency background with luxury FMCG experience and excellent project management skills. The position is contract-based and offers an immediate start in a hybrid working environment.
